SLIAC ANNOUNCES ATHLETES OF THE WEEK FOR DECEMBER 3-9
ST. LOUIS - The St. Louis Intercollegiate Athletic Conference (SLIAC)
has announced the Athletes of the Week for the week of December 3-9.
MEN'S BASKETBALL
Westminster College's Andrew Buxton, a senior from Wildwood,
Mo. (Lafayette), has been named the SLIAC Men's Basketball Player
of the Week for the week of December 3-9.
Buxton, a guard, scored 46 points in two games last week, leading the
Blue Jays to two victories versus Maryville University (Mo.) and
Greenville College. In the two games he hit 17-of-31 from the field,
4-of-11 from behind the arc and was a perfect 8-of-8 from the charity
stripe. He also tallied three assists, four steals and had just two
turnovers in 63 minutes on the court.
Buxton scored 19 points and grabbed four rebounds in a 82-61 win versus
Maryville. He then recorded 27 points and seven rebounds in a 73-59 win
versus Greenville. The two wins marked the first time since the 1995-96

Eureka College's Nicole Fisher, a senior from Canton,
Ill., has been named the SLIAC Women's Basketball Player
of the Week for the week of December 3-9. Fisher,
a 5-10 forward, has recorded four consecutive double-doubles and broke a
22-year old Eureka school record for rebounds in a game with 22 versus
Blackburn College last week. She also had 26 points on 8-of-15 shooting
from the field and 10-of-14 from the free throw line as the Red Devils
lost 65-60 to the Beavers.
Fisher then tallied 19 points and 19 rebounds to
lead Eureka to their first win of the season with a 68-43 home victory
versus Principia College. She shot 5-of-12 from the field, 9-of-11 from
the free throw line and added two steals in the win. Fisher also moves
into the top five on Eureka's career rebounding list; she currently
ranks fourth with 638 career rebounds. |
